A management consultant, programme director and trainer with over 23 years of experience, Dr. Odejide holds a B.Sc. in Computer Science and Engineering, an MBA, and a PhD in Management Information Systems and Information Security. An MSECB Certified Auditor since 2016 who has conducted more than 150 institutional audits, his approach is anchored in over 20 ISO and management certifications — among them ISO 27001, ISO 22301, ISO 9001 and ISO 31000, alongside PMP, PRINCE2, TOGAF and Lean Six Sigma Black Belt.
